Edge Computing For Instantaneous Shop Floor Response

In manufacturing, latency can mean the difference between a quality product and a batch of scrap. Relying on the cloud for critical process control is too slow. We leverage edge computing to process data directly on your factory floor, enabling instantaneous feedback loops and real-time decision-making. This architecture ensures that automated quality checks, machine adjustments, and safety alerts happen immediately, without the delay of a round trip to a remote server. It delivers the speed and reliability that high-performance industrial operations demand.

Closing The Loop Between PLM And Production

A disconnect between product lifecycle management (PLM) and the shop floor leads to version control issues and costly production errors. We build a digital thread that connects your engineering bill of materials (eBOM) from your PLM system directly to the manufacturing bill of materials (mBOM) used in production. This ensures that operators are always working with the latest approved design specifications and work instructions. Automating this data transfer eliminates manual errors, accelerates new product introductions, and ensures engineering changes are implemented flawlessly.

Let AI Optimize Your Production Schedule

Manual production scheduling is complex and rarely optimal. Our platforms can integrate AI to analyze material availability, machine capacity, labor skills, and changeover times to generate superior schedules dynamically. The system learns from past performance to improve future recommendations, helping you maximize throughput and reduce lead times. When a priority order arrives or a machine goes down, the AI can instantly re-optimize the entire schedule, providing a level of agility that is impossible to achieve manually.
